The rank (0–100) uses a weighted average of the Sharpe, Sortino, Omega, Calmar, and Martin percentile ranks for the trailing 12 months. Higher means stronger historical risk-adjusted performance within the peer group.

This table presents a comparison of risk-adjusted performance metrics for AGF U.S. Market Neutral Anti-Beta Fund (BTAL) and Federated Hermes MDT Market Neutral ETF (MKTN). Risk-adjusted metrics are performance indicators that assess an investment's returns in relation to its risk, enabling a more accurate comparison of different investment options.

Values are calculated on a 1-year rolling basis and updated daily. Risk-adjusted metrics are more stable over longer periods — use the period switch above to explore them.
